The top 10 tourist destinations in North Africa


1- Marrakech, Morocco:

 Known for its vibrant souks, traditional riads, and stunning architecture, Marrakech is a top destination for tourists in North Africa.



2- Cairo, Egypt:

 Home to the Pyramids of Giza and the Sphinx, Cairo is a must-visit for history buffs and anyone interested in ancient civilizations.



3- Tunis, Tunisia: 

Tunis is a charming city with a medina (old town) that dates back to the 8th century, as well as beautiful beaches and Roman ruins.




4- Fez, Morocco:

 Fez is known for its well-preserved medieval architecture and bustling souks, as well as its famous tanneries.



5- Luxor, Egypt:

 Another ancient city in Egypt, Luxor is home to the Valley of the Kings, where many pharaohs were buried, and the Karnak Temple Complex.



6- Algiers, Algeria:

 Algiers is a city with a rich history and beautiful architecture, including the Kasbah of Algiers and the Notre-Dame d'Afrique.



7- Aswan, Egypt:

 Aswan is a small city located along the Nile River that is known for its relaxed atmosphere and picturesque landscapes, including the Aswan Dam and Elephantine Island.



8- Chefchaouen, Morocco: 

Chefchaouen is a small town in the Rif Mountains that is known for its blue-painted buildings and stunning views.



9- El Jadida, Morocco:

 El Jadida is a coastal city that is known for its Portuguese architecture, including the El Jadida Citadel and Cistern.



10- Sousse, Tunisia:

 Sousse is a popular beach resort town that is known for its Mediterranean climate, sandy beaches, and historic medina.
